技术领域 technical field
本实用新型涉及银幕领域技术,尤其是指一种座地直拉式大型银幕。The utility model relates to the technology in the field of screens, in particular to a ground-mounted straight-pull large-scale screen.
背景技术 Background technique
随着科学技术的突飞猛进,投影设备得以普及,在日常的会议解说、电化教学等场所均会涉及使用到相关银幕进行演示,而因传统的银幕存在笨重、体积大、搬运困难之缺陷,使得业者渐渐朝轻巧、方便携带之设计理念发展,以实现使用方便性之目的。With the rapid development of science and technology, projection equipment has been popularized, and related screens are used for demonstrations in daily conference explanations, audio-visual teaching and other places. However, the traditional screens are heavy, bulky, and difficult to carry. Gradually develop towards the design concept of light weight and easy to carry, in order to achieve the purpose of ease of use.
当今,市场上出现了多种不同形成的伸缩式银幕,其中可参阅中国专利ZL03213409.6所公开的便携式落地投影屏幕,该投影屏幕包括在屏幕的上部的顶杆,顶杆上设置的提升板,在屏幕的背面伸缩臂上设置上转节和下转节,而下转节与气压(液压)缸连接,提升板与上转节连接;利用气压(液压)缸驱使下转节伸缩与收合实现屏幕的伸缩性之目的,然而因气压(液压)缸成本较高,不利于市场竞争,特别是气压(液压)缸的在长期工作状态下,必然会因尘埃等杂物入侵,使其附著于伸缩支撑杆上,从而导致气压(液压)缸的工作不稳定,操作不顺,给消费者带来使用之困扰。Today, a variety of retractable screens with different forms appear on the market, among which can refer to the portable floor-standing projection screen disclosed in Chinese patent ZL03213409.6. , the upper and lower rotary joints are set on the telescopic arm on the back of the screen, and the lower rotary joint is connected with the pneumatic (hydraulic) cylinder, and the lifting plate is connected with the upper rotary joint; the pneumatic (hydraulic) cylinder is used to drive the lower rotary joint to expand and contract. However, due to the high cost of the pneumatic (hydraulic) cylinder, it is not conducive to market competition, especially in the long-term working state of the pneumatic (hydraulic) cylinder, it will inevitably be invaded by dust and other debris, making it Attached to the telescopic support rod, resulting in unstable work of the pneumatic (hydraulic) cylinder and unsmooth operation, which brings troubles to consumers.
实用新型内容Utility model content
本实用新型针对现有技术所存在之缺陷,主要目的在于提供一种操作顺畅、成本低的座地直拉式大型银幕。The utility model aims at the defects of the prior art, and its main purpose is to provide a floor-mounted straight-pull large-scale screen with smooth operation and low cost.
为实现上述之目的,本实用新型采取如下技术方案:In order to achieve the above-mentioned purpose, the utility model takes the following technical solutions:
一种座地直拉式大型银幕,包括底盒及拉杆,该底盒的扭簧上卷绕着屏幕,屏幕的另一端与拉杆固接,在底盒及拉杆之间铰接有可伸缩的连杆机构,该连杆机构与底盒的铰接端设有一用以限制连杆运动的齿轮组。A large-scale straight-pull screen sitting on the ground, including a bottom box and a pull rod. The screen is wound around the torsion spring of the bottom box, and the other end of the screen is fixedly connected to the pull rod. A telescopic connection is hinged between the bottom box and the pull rod. A rod mechanism, the hinged end of the connecting rod mechanism and the bottom box is provided with a gear set for limiting the movement of the connecting rod.
该连杆机构包括两相互交叉铰接的连接中杆,该两连接中杆两端均对应铰接有连接顶杆和连接底杆,该连接顶杆铰接在拉杆上,而连接底杆由上述齿轮组铰接在底盒上。The link mechanism includes two connecting middle rods cross-hinged with each other, and the two ends of the two connecting middle rods are respectively hinged with connecting top rods and connecting bottom rods. Hinged to the bottom box.
该齿轮组由两组可相互啮合的齿轮和与各齿轮配合的轴转机构组成,该轴转机构包括一与齿轮匹配的轴套、齿轮轴以及支架,轴套装于连接底杆固接的齿轮连接杆上,齿轮轴套于轴套中,且固定在支架上。The gear set consists of two sets of gears that can mesh with each other and a shaft-rotating mechanism that cooperates with each gear. The shaft-rotating mechanism includes a shaft sleeve that matches the gears, a gear shaft and a bracket. On the connecting rod, the gear shaft is sleeved in the shaft sleeve and fixed on the bracket.
在连接底杆与底盒之间交叉斜拉有一可平衡连杆机构)整体受力的拉簧。Between connecting the bottom bar and the bottom box, there is a tension spring which can balance the overall stress of the connecting rod and the bottom box.
本实用新型与现有技术相比,其优点是利用齿轮组取代现有技术中的气压(液压)缸来控制连杆机构之伸缩状态,其克服了气压(液压)缸所存在的局限性,因此也就实现了操作顺畅、成本低之目的。Compared with the prior art, the utility model has the advantage of using the gear set to replace the pneumatic (hydraulic) cylinder in the prior art to control the telescopic state of the connecting rod mechanism, which overcomes the limitations of the pneumatic (hydraulic) cylinder, Therefore, the purpose of smooth operation and low cost is achieved.

具体实施方式Detailed ways
下面结合附图与具体实施方式对本实用新型作进一步描述。The utility model will be further described below in conjunction with the accompanying drawings and specific embodiments.
请参阅图1~图4所示,一种座地直拉式大型银幕,包括底盒1及拉杆2,该底盒1的扭簧3上卷绕着屏幕4,屏幕4的另一端与拉杆2固接,使屏幕4在扭簧3的作用下收容于底盒1内,当对拉杆2施以拉力的情形下,屏幕4会沿扭簧4渐渐展开。Please refer to Figures 1 to 4, a floor-mounted straight-pull large-scale screen includes a
在底盒1及拉杆2之间铰接有可伸缩的连杆机构5,故在屏幕4展开后由连杆机构5给予支撑;该连杆机构5与底盒1的铰接端设有一齿轮组6,以利用该齿轮组6的齿轮间啮合可限制连杆的展开后得以定位。A telescopic link mechanism 5 is hinged between the
上述连杆机构5包括两相互交叉铰接的连接中杆51,该两连接中杆51两端均对应铰接有连接顶杆52和连接底杆53,该连接顶杆52铰接在拉杆2上,而连接底杆53由上述齿轮组6铰接在底盒1上,如此可以使连杆机构5保持稳定,避免晃动现象的产生。The above-mentioned link mechanism 5 includes two connecting
该齿轮组6由两组可相互啮合的齿轮61和与各齿轮61配合的轴转机构组成,该轴转机构包括一与齿轮61匹配的轴套62、齿轮轴63以及支架64,支架64是固定在底盒1上;轴套62装于连接底杆53固接的齿轮连接杆7上,齿轮轴63套于轴套62中,且固接在支架64上。This
在连接底杆53与底盒1之间交叉斜拉有一可平衡连杆机构5整体受力的拉簧8,因此,当收合屏幕4时只需利用拉簧8打破连杆机构5的平衡受力即可实现快捷收合之目的。Between the connecting
在底盒1的底部枢接有两个可旋转的脚底11,当脚底11旋转至垂直底盒1状态下即可使整个银幕更好地落地,当该脚底11旋入即可隐藏,使其不影响整体外观美感;上述拉杆2的顶部设有一提手部21,以利消费者操作。There are two
本实用新型之工作原理是:消费者通过提手部21将拉杆2施向外拉力,使屏幕4绕扭簧3展开,连杆机构5随之伸展,当展开一定高度位置后,由齿轮组6中的齿轮61相互啮合,将连杆机构5下方的连接底杆53定位,且由连接底杆53与底盒1之间的拉簧8平衡整个连杆机构5的受力,进而借助连杆机构5的整体性将屏幕4支撑起来;消费者若需收合屏幕时,只需给拉杆2施一外力,其中可打破拉簧8的受力平衡,同时在扭簧3的共同作用下将屏幕4卷起,与此同时连杆机构5也随之收合。The working principle of the utility model is: the consumer pulls the
本实用新型之设计重点在于通过齿轮组取代现有技术中的气压(液压)缸来控制连杆机构之伸缩状态,其克服了气压(液压)缸所存在的局限性,因此也就实现了操作顺畅、成本低之目的。The key point of the design of the utility model is to replace the pneumatic (hydraulic) cylinder in the prior art by the gear set to control the expansion and contraction state of the connecting rod mechanism, which overcomes the limitations of the pneumatic (hydraulic) cylinder, and thus realizes the operation Smooth, low-cost purposes.
